As graduation comes sooner than any of us anticipated, it's easy to feel a rush of emotions. Despite the sadness of leaving the place you called home for the past four years and the anxiety of going out into the world to do whatever it is you are meant to do, I think we can all agree on one emotion that is definitely the most predominant: excitement.

We've worked our butts off to get to where we are today. We are finally going to get that piece of paper that opens endless doors for us. I think it's safe to say we're all feeling about as cocky as the founding father on the $10 bill.

Here are 10 lyrics from the Hamilton musical that any college grad should use as an Instagram caption to toot their own horn as loud as good ol' Alexander himself.
